Job Title: Instructional Designer
Location: Grand Rapids MI / Hybrid
Duration: 12 months
Description:
Department: Claims Training
The Instructional Designer is responsible for designing learning experiences that solve business problems through the thoughtful combination of communications eLearning instructor-led training performance support and other interventions. They ensure that high-quality innovative and effective learning solutions are designed developed and delivered by different teams in a timely manner to satisfy business needs.
Required Skills:
- Conduct data gathering and analysis to understand business strategy requirements.
- Provide direction for short and long-term planning sessions and provide direction to ensure understanding of business goals and direction
- Engage with stakeholders from different parts of the business to rapidly analyze their needs and design high-level learning solutions that may include a range of low medium and high-fidelity learning interventions.
- Three (3) years experience utilizing multimedia tools such as Captivate Camtasia Articulate Storyline Illustrator preferred.
- Ability to conduct a need analysis to design and develop materials to support training and end-users for projects implementations & initiatives for internal external and self-service customers.
- Experience in designing and developing computer-based training storyboards and lessons to be used in a variety of delivery media is required
- Provide analytical support related to business applications infrastructure and technology related activities.
- Design code test debug document implement and maintain complex business applications. Provide ongoing maintenance of applications
- May serve as subject matter expert related to interface problem identification triage and resolution of complex productivity efficiency and accuracy in our computer systems.
- Develop performance-based training and development systems to meet operational needs and requirements.
Education:
- Bachelors degree in Instructional Technology Training & Development Technical Communications or related field preferred
